This is a very simple implementation of this crazy method of making read only hashs become faster with no collisions.
A very simple implementation of this crazy method of making read only hashs become faster with no collision, normally use GPERF for that is much more robust then this simple test code. This proves that the Odin hash function is really really fast. We can beet it but just for a small ammount.
MPHF - Minimum Perfect Hashing Function : 10.98 ns
Normal Odin Haspmap get : 13.27 ns
